Book 1~Bahubali Before The Beginning~THE RISE OF SIVAGAMI BY ANAND NEELAKANTANThis novel talks about everything that happened before the beginning of Bahubali. The story is centred around Sivagami, the future queen of Mahishmathi. It depicts the story when Sivagami was a teenage girl. As in all the Bahubali movies this story also has many characters, which makes it more interesting for the readers.This story is about how Sivagami became a part of the palace officials. In this story, Sivagami hates Mahishmathi and it's king Maharaj Somdeva since her father was been executed by him for treason. This is about her journey from an orphanage to becoming a bhoomipathi of Mahishmathi.You will also read about Kattappa during his teenage life. You will come to know about his family & how he became such a great warrior. The story depicts his suffering & struggle to survive in this master & slave lifestyle. You will experience how he has to take tough decisions in his life.You will also come across Bijjaladeva & Mahadeva. You will come to know about Prince Mahadeva as you have hardly known about him from the movies.The author has described the orthodox thinking in a brilliant manner, the master and slave lifestyle, the cast based designation and ill treatment that was followed during the olden days. As you will expect from a Bahubali book, it has fighting and war scenes poured down brilliantly in terms of words.The story is very interesting as Sivagami hates Mahishmathi then how she became the queen of Mahishmathi. The story ends at very interesting point where Sivagami is declared as a bhoomipathi which makes you think about will she take her revenge or not, hence you will also be waiting for it's next edition.

Well written but not as per my expectation because...
Being a huge Bahubali movie series fan I thought this book should be a must read. The book started off really well and it got me captivated instantly. However as the book progressed instances of atrocities on women started creeping in ..not once but several times. I cant say if elaborating such instances is right or wrong. All I can say that Bahubali movies had ZERO depiction of such cases. Even when there was one ... both the Bahubalis chopped of that guys head(1st movie where Bhalla son was beheaded and 2nd movie it was Senapati). And that makes this fantastic Epic movie so great and larger than life and entertaining. And specially for kids. Which is why I was really surprised how did they take this different approach for the book. I would have honestly enjoyed the book a lot more had there been less elaboration on seduction, molestation, etc. It was really disturbing ...even though its a fiction. Having said that the book is very well written ..no doubt about it and after reading the book you will love the popular characters of Sivagami and Kattapa more and would want to wait for the next book. So is a definite read for Bahubali fans but NOT for kids.

A little disappointing but showed promise for future!
The story started interestingly but slowed often and defied logic in many places. Fight sequences especially on a ship seemed illogical and unrealistically prolonged given all other information on that scene. Why would a dangerous pirate be allowed the freedom to move about after capture and allowed the opportunity to jump ship while putting in danger those in charge? Also, who is sailing and navigating the ship through a supposedly very dangerous stretch of the river, while everyone seems busy baiting and interrogating the captured pirate?There was some indication that Sivagami was trained in combat by her guardian in the early part of the book, but very little evidence of this training was on display whenever she faced danger, which was really disappointing. Towards the end when Sivagami is facing the villains who have just murdered the Prime Minister (?) in front of her, is it not natural instinct for any person, let alone a young girl like Sivagami, to run away from danger? Instead she runs towards the victim and danger, when all she had to do was to step out the nearest window to escape, especially when the PM begged her to run before he was killed! Unfortunately she just stood there like a deer caught on car headlights and runs towards the murdered victim. I am sorry to be critical, but I felt that this story had so much more potential than what has been delivered. The lead character Sivagami seemed ready to cry at the drop of a hat, passive and allow things to happen around her and to her without taking much by way of positive action. I wonder if the lead character was a male of the same age, the author might have imagined greater freedom of action? This is the first book by this author that I have read, I hope he will imagine the lead characters (especially female) in adventure stories like this to be more confident and positive in future books. There is plenty of basis for such heroines all around the world including India, such as female warriors, warrior queens, leaders and strategists both in mythology and actuality as my daughters never fail to educate me!
